Kurt Partridge
4fa6e57260
ResearchLogging indicator
...
- shows a indicator that logging is on. two options are available: an obvious
red outline around the keyboard, and a subtle red dot in the lower right-hand
corner. currently configured for the subtle red dot.
Bug: 6188932
Change-Id: I0fd1ac5a0f20329adc603aa65ab85f2d38b9fc43
2012-07-22 19:04:34 -07:00
Kurt Partridge
74c95d6d18
Merge "ResearchLog splash screen"
2012-07-22 18:53:38 -07:00
Kurt Partridge
f0c6606807
Merge "ResearchLogger feedback form"
2012-07-22 18:53:30 -07:00
Kurt Partridge
4331012a9e
ResearchLog splash screen
...
Bug: 6188932
Change-Id: I1b247ecc26a2dd4f3f1c1b1cd3d928af717ebdd5
2012-07-22 18:36:43 -07:00
Kurt Partridge
3c233bf1a5
ResearchLogger feedback form
...
- also cleaned up RLog menu
multi-project commit with If0fd4fef89d390073e6939d5188ed5696866cb33
Bug: 6188932
Change-Id: I4f66f13bd366b4e8bde742ccd0704f812c6d33f9
2012-07-22 18:36:24 -07:00
Tom Ouyang
ccaa799ee9
Update gesture bounding box handling.
...
Change-Id: I085611ce6fd82608f284d74973e5bb14258cdc24
2012-07-22 10:54:27 +09:00
Kurt Partridge
7e220d3c3a
Merge "ResearchLog uploading"
2012-07-21 00:26:48 -07:00
Kurt Partridge
9c539d5a5c
ResearchLog uploading
...
- uploads files in the background to server
multi-project commit with Ie0d937773e04b2fbefc8d76c231aaa52ebc392c9
Bug: 6188932
Change-Id: I90bb0e237eeb567e4cbb51085f2229f17f1fe71c
2012-07-20 15:24:48 -07:00
Kurt Partridge
e6f68f2944
Merge "ResearchLog refactor"
2012-07-20 15:22:30 -07:00
Kurt Partridge
6b966160ac
ResearchLog refactor
...
- new package: com.android.inputmethod.research
multi-project commit with Ic0a5744f3160d13218addd589890623c0d120ffc
Bug: 6188932
Change-Id: Icf8d4a40a5725401799be6e209a640d99a5f34c4
2012-07-20 15:06:51 -07:00
Ying Wang
2d097dd567
Import translations. DO NOT MERGE
...
Change-Id: Ie15a817f13d3ce0a87eeff8334824fd3a337c1bc
Auto-generated-cl: translation import
2012-07-20 13:28:37 -07:00
Tadashi G. Takaoka
7519091f7c
Use ResizableIntArray in GestureStroke
...
Change-Id: I034e80df03c7c6c0895fdf2c03763627d410d425
2012-07-20 19:32:28 +09:00
Tadashi G. Takaoka
2474b37abd
Merge "Disable gesture input detection when more keys keyboard is showing"
2012-07-20 03:28:52 -07:00
Tadashi G. Takaoka
62b8dddb6d
Add gesture input enable settings
...
Bug: 6845325
Change-Id: I3165465b0b280e32a9288da16abb75baa67288dc
2012-07-20 19:26:36 +09:00
Tadashi G. Takaoka
cc3500b0c8
Disable gesture input detection when more keys keyboard is showing
...
Bug: 6852441
2012-07-20 18:40:31 +09:00
Tom Ouyang
b8bd45a22a
Merge "Fix bug where key previews do not show up."
2012-07-20 02:06:29 -07:00
Tom Ouyang
c022a9f8d4
Fix bug where key previews do not show up.
...
Bug: 6852705
Change-Id: Ib90107a5dde774b4d6c1e570629ce7f7eaff44bc
2012-07-20 18:02:12 +09:00
Ken Wakasa
afed0567e9
Performance improvements - Avoid using iterators
...
Change-Id: Iab604aa1ef67acf5d54208a6bc44635632845ae0
2012-07-20 17:51:52 +09:00
Tom Ouyang
528738341d
Merge "Add gesture trail feedback."
2012-07-20 01:26:30 -07:00
Tom Ouyang
4daf32b6c0
Add gesture trail feedback.
...
Change-Id: I32709fac0dec3165678a052aa286e2fb3d90721b
2012-07-20 17:09:23 +09:00
Tadashi G. Takaoka
2f6a90ac31
Merge "Implement ResizableIntArray.fill"
2012-07-20 00:33:07 -07:00
Tadashi G. Takaoka
7abdcf1ed3
Implement ResizableIntArray.fill
...
Change-Id: I570641bc2f32d016c247db6c065a138d8235ab8c
2012-07-20 16:05:37 +09:00
Tadashi G. Takaoka
732edc1ff1
Merge "Fix NPE where the current subtype is null"
2012-07-19 22:57:39 -07:00
Tadashi G. Takaoka
d6a18cdedb
Fix NPE where the current subtype is null
...
Bug: 6847999
2012-07-20 14:51:41 +09:00
Kurt Partridge
48ded4e3b1
Merge "ResearchLogger: make logging more reliable (esp on startup)"
2012-07-19 21:31:41 -07:00
Tadashi G. Takaoka
19ac19e5fd
Merge "Implement ResizableIntArray.setLength and .get"
2012-07-19 20:44:54 -07:00
Ken Wakasa
2fc127698a
Make ALPHA_OPAQUE public
...
Change-Id: I904685be07e23292dd95296617a4b64c366f06f2
2012-07-20 12:17:31 +09:00
Tadashi G. Takaoka
c49c85f835
Implement ResizableIntArray.setLength and .get
...
This change revises ResizableIntArrayTests as well.
2012-07-20 12:02:38 +09:00
Tom Ouyang
a50ed0c56c
Merge "Improve incremental gesture tracking."
2012-07-19 19:14:01 -07:00
Tom Ouyang
0c5f72e2bf
Improve incremental gesture tracking.
...
Eliminates need to recreate batch InputPointers on each gesture move event.
Fixes issue where batch points from previous tapping input get mixed into next gesture.
Change-Id: I9ecac66db88f5a87c6dde2138408906dd3d11139
2012-07-20 10:44:37 +09:00
Ying Wang
721fd573f0
Import translations. DO NOT MERGE
...
Change-Id: I0122e62e7f9cf50d3987dc80018f2e9e78ed3f87
Auto-generated-cl: translation import
2012-07-19 14:56:45 -07:00
Kurt Partridge
0df487678e
ResearchLogger: make logging more reliable (esp on startup)
...
Bug: 6188932
Change-Id: I692e427ba2e6da7bb15f48208304c4a034392a22
2012-07-19 09:00:21 -07:00
The Android Open Source Project
d323ac913c
am 76533ab5: Reconcile with jb-mr0-release
...
* commit '76533ab5926089ffde286cd34090eddfc5b9d947':
2012-07-19 08:52:31 -07:00
The Android Open Source Project
76533ab592
Reconcile with jb-mr0-release
...
Change-Id: Icff9883db37162d72b2fb24f4d03ef09112a3149
2012-07-19 08:41:48 -07:00
Tadashi G. Takaoka
9370ab9ada
Make ScalableIntArray public as ResizableIntArray
...
Change-Id: Ibbbc117214912ffa192c694bde5b7d55154f40c4
2012-07-19 20:37:53 +09:00
Tadashi G. Takaoka
4fe0a8e620
Merge "Update InputPointers unit test comments"
2012-07-19 04:02:53 -07:00
Tadashi G. Takaoka
f583098887
Update InputPointers unit test comments
2012-07-19 20:02:01 +09:00
Tom Ouyang
0b24e42233
Merge "Add wrapper for incremental decoder."
2012-07-19 03:03:06 -07:00
Tadashi G. Takaoka
1e6f39a9f9
Tune the gesture detection logic a bit
...
Change-Id: Ia8e8c15fdbbd49768d57cafd50325e7e45af6251
2012-07-19 18:53:39 +09:00
Tom Ouyang
eb2fe2ab10
Add wrapper for incremental decoder.
...
Change-Id: Ie11e2b83c2602c0d5a2739a7d4f4994f80d7e298
2012-07-19 17:50:40 +09:00
Tadashi G. Takaoka
918e420d1b
Gesture input should be turned off depending on the configuration
...
The gesture input will be disabled when
* It is AOSP build.
* Accessibility mode is on.
* The input field is password mode.
Bug: 6844755
Bug: 6844763
Bug: 6845011
Change-Id: I74972cc765d15c08059e0c9014f863ffb2a57c6c
2012-07-19 16:33:09 +09:00
The Android Automerger
289d40a3aa
merge in jb-release history after reset to jb-dev
2012-07-18 23:04:51 -07:00
Tadashi G. Takaoka
57f7de0ba6
Add default capacity parameter to InputPointers' constructor
...
Change-Id: I02f23096f0682d30effe4dfc1ca57881a1e4aedc
2012-07-19 12:06:00 +09:00
Ying Wang
71b772ec58
Import translations. DO NOT MERGE
...
Change-Id: I4ba29a164c70eb3db5afbb502a81d32088813ba4
Auto-generated-cl: translation import
2012-07-18 17:05:01 -07:00
Tadashi G. Takaoka
9580c467f9
Consolidate GestureTracker into PointerTracker
...
Change-Id: Ib28fae10493a9142ba4dff6cf57f52c59766b209
2012-07-18 20:11:06 +09:00
Tadashi G. Takaoka
10102f02af
Change the batch input methods of KeyboardActionListener
...
This change also removes the reference of SuggestedWords from
GestureTracker and KeyboardActionListener.
Change-Id: I25ef8756007986abf99a931afd665bbfe6fa387f
2012-07-18 18:53:36 +09:00
Tadashi G. Takaoka
f39fccbd0f
Make GestureStroke as top level class
...
And make PointerTracker object has GestureStroke object.
Change-Id: Ibf5cfd593c4f13468368e01acb847589b0ab12e7
2012-07-18 17:32:17 +09:00
Tadashi G. Takaoka
3ec31f4971
A gesture should not start from the delete key
...
Change-Id: I5c8c7665454b7f10f944f307431dfffe20cf3134
2012-07-18 14:38:51 +09:00
Ying Wang
e3c0301b31
Import translations. DO NOT MERGE
...
Change-Id: If1f6cea5414e0033139babda4a8afc459fd656cc
Auto-generated-cl: translation import
2012-07-17 13:29:26 -07:00
Ken Wakasa
8788dffe6f
Increase the config_key_hysteresis_distance value for tablet form factor devices
...
bug: 6745169
Change-Id: I4f0c018748b12d42d5ef587d93df3c5521623b36
2012-07-17 18:36:37 +09:00